Channel Description
EnjoyFirefighting Productions - Emergency vehicles responding with lights and sirens to their calls: all kinds fire departments, emergency medical service, police services, disaster management organizations, federal agencies ... here you find 'em all. Both from Europe and from Northern America, especially from Germany, Norway, Sweden and the United States.
Wanna have a foretaste? Here we go: heavy armored SWAT trucks, fire truck convoys, large capacity ambulance buses, patrol cars flying at high speeds through traffic, ride-alongs in rescue vehicles, didaster drills with up to 300 units, and real disaster scenes like NYC during hurricane Sandy ... and believe me: THIS is just the beginning!
